## Runbook: Vendoring third-party fonts for Typecask

When a customer reports missing glyphs, odds are a vendored font didn't make it into the bundle. We vendor fonts into the assets repo rather than pulling from upstream at build time — keeps builds reproducible and avoids license surprises. Each vendored font gets a row in the fonts ledger: family, version, license tag, checksum. Check that row first before escalating. The ledger lives in the assets database, reachable via the string below.

primary connection of yagep-kahip = redis://giliel_svc:zYiKsLL2PLpfPL@db-348f.xolmarsys.corp:5432/fenwyn

☐ Step 4 — Partner SFTP drop. Before we rotate the Marrowfield signing keys, double-check that the outbound drop to the Quillhaven partner feed is paused — otherwise they'll pull files signed with the retiring key and reject the whole batch. Reviewer signs off here, then the ceremony lead re-enables the drop. To unlock the rotation console, enter the recovery passphrase below.

vault phrase of kafog-kahif = holdor-rusir-praox

## Runbook: consent banner rollout (Dovetail UI)

Roll out region-by-region: Nordhaven first, then Caldera. Flag: `consent_banner_v2`. Verify banner renders before any tracker loads; if not, halt and revert flag. Legal copy is versioned in the `bannertext` bundle — never hand-edit. Bundle must be signed before publish or the client rejects it at startup. Sign the bundle with the deploy key listed below.

rollout seal: bky4_sSmA

## Thumbnail Queue

Welcome aboard! The Pinwheel thumbnail queue takes uploads from Snaploft, resizes them, and drops results into blob storage. It's mostly hands-off, but when it backs up you'll want to tweak worker counts and batch sizes rather than restarting things blindly. The defaults we run in production are the following.

tuning constants:
QUOTAS = {
    "druwyn": 5,
    "holix": 5,
    "zorath": 5,
    "holwyn": 10,
}